#44e1a2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#44e1a2 is composed of 26.7% red, 88.2%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 28%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 155.9 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 57.5%. #44e1a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ffff with #00c345.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#44e1a2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03100b is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#44e1a2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9693 is the less saturated color, while #2bfaa7 is the most saturated one.
